Frequently Asked Questions about Chelsea
What type of rentals are currently available in Chelsea?
There are currently 1924 Apartments for Rent in Chelsea, NY with pricing that ranges from $1,900 to $24,995. There are also 346 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Chelsea ranging from $1,730 to $30,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Chelsea?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Chelsea ranges from $1,730 to $30,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,130.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Chelsea?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Chelsea range from $5,890 to $24,995,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,180 to $30,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,730 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$7,649.
